Analysis
In 2023, lifetime risk of maternal death in Monaco stood at 10,688 1 in: rate varies by country.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 5.1% on the previous year and down 4.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, lifetime risk of maternal death in Monaco peaked at 12,768 1 in: rate varies by country in 2003 and was at its lowest, 1,893 1 in: rate varies by country, in 1985.
Monaco ranks 39th of 194 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 39 years of available data.

About this data
Life time risk of maternal death is the probability that a 15-year-old female will die eventually from a maternal cause assuming that current levels of fertility and mortality (including maternal mortality) do not change in the future, taking into account competing causes of death.
